The Wine & Food Foundation of Texas held a Toast and Roast event showcasing Texas Monthly\’s Best Texas Wines of 2014. The event took place on the beautiful grounds of Rancho Cuernavaca. The fabulous evening started off with a sip and stroll where guests mixed and mingled while enjoying Texas\’ best wines.

Chef Bates roasting a TenderBelly hog |
Chef Bates and his team were behind the incredible feast which included a whole hog, lamb, goat, and Noble Sandwich Co.\’s favorite sides to include jalapeno slaw, pork and beans, herbed potato salad, house-made breads and assorted bite-sized tarts.

I have an amazing time at all the Wine & Food Foundation of Texas events I have attended and I love the feel good feeling from attending as their events benefit the community. Through their philanthropy program many of the The Wine & Food Foundation of Texas\’ events benefit nonprofits in our community to include Dell Children\’s Medical Center, Austin Food for Life, the Sustainable Food Center and Texas A&M Viticulture & Fruit Lab.
